The Anti-Poverty Network of New Jersey (APN), a member of the New Jersey Advocacy Network to End Homelessness, will host the 10th Annual Anti-Poverty Conference on Tuesday, December 8, 2009 in Trenton, NJ.

During lunch, the Advocacy Network to End Homelessness and the Anti-Poverty Network will present an award to Senator Dana L. Redd (D-Camden) for her support of the County Homeless Trust Fund legislation. Senator Redd, not only sponsored the legislation but actively advocated for its passage. She is now actively working with the Advocacy Network to have counties throughout New Jersey establish the trust funds so that they can end homelessness in their communities.
